What are the consequences of exposing his mistress sin?

3 Answers2026-05-16 10:16:19
Exposing someone's infidelity is like pulling the pin on a grenade—it explodes everything in its path. I've seen friendships dissolve overnight when secrets like this come out. The betrayed partner often goes through a whirlwind of emotions—anger, humiliation, grief—and it can shatter their trust in people permanently. Some relationships never recover, while others limp forward with resentment festering beneath the surface.

Then there's the social fallout. Mutual friends might pick sides, workplaces gossip, and the mistress could face public humiliation. But here's the messy part: sometimes, the truth does more harm than good. If the affair was a one-time mistake or already over, exposing it might just reopen wounds for no real benefit. I’ve watched people weaponize 'honesty' to hurt others rather than to heal, and that’s where it feels ugly.

Where can I read about exposing his mistress's sin?

3 Answers2026-05-08 21:40:19
If you're looking for stories where a mistress's misdeeds are exposed, you might want to dive into dramatic fiction or revenge-themed narratives. There's a whole subgenre of novels and web serials where betrayed characters meticulously unravel their partner's infidelity—think 'The Other Woman' by Sandie Jones or even classic thrillers like 'Gone Girl', where secrets and sins are laid bare in spectacular fashion.

Online platforms like Wattpad or Radish often host user-generated stories with this exact premise, full of juicy reveals and cathartic takedowns. I’ve stumbled across a few where the protagonist goes full detective mode, planting hidden cameras or leaking texts to social media. It’s messy, addictive, and sometimes uncomfortably relatable—like watching a train wreck you can’t look away from. Just be prepared for some over-the-top melodrama; these plots thrive on escalation.

Where can I read about exposing his mistress’s sins?

5 Answers2026-06-04 13:23:17
You know, I stumbled upon this topic while browsing some drama-filled forums a while back. There's this novel called 'The Other Woman' that dives deep into the emotional turmoil of infidelity, though it's more about the personal journey than outright exposing sins. For real-life stories, Reddit communities like r/relationshipadvice or r/Infidelity often have raw, unfiltered confessions and discussions. Some threads even detail how people uncovered their partner's affairs, complete with screenshots and receipts.

If you're looking for something more structured, investigative podcasts like 'Something Was Wrong' dissect toxic relationships layer by layer. It’s chilling how some episodes mirror the exact scenario you’re asking about—hidden messages, double lives, the works. Just be prepared; these stories can get heavy real fast.
